The Space Between

For this project I was focusing on the negative space created by two or more buildings in an urban setting. In order to help the viewer focus more on the negative space rather than the buildings, I flipped the images upside down and darkened the buildings. Viewers tend to search for and focus more on what they know in images so I wanted to challenge myself to see if I could get them to focus on a new form created by me.
